✦ Synopsis


Symmetric dicarboxylic acids, ranging from pentanedioic acid to tetradecanedioic acid, gave selectively the corresponding monoesters in high yields in the transestedfication catalyzed by strongly acidic ion-exchange resins in ester/octane mixtures.
